Homes for Cathy Homes for Cathy is a national alliance of housing associations, charities and local authorities working together to end homelessness. Homes for Cathy was formed in 2016 to mark 50 years since the release of Ken Loach’s Cathy Come Home. We wanted to show that homelessness is still a significant and prevalent issue, […]

Our approach to safeguarding Safeguarding is about protecting people from harm, abuse, and neglect – especially those who may not be able to speak up for themselves, like children, young people, and vulnerable adults. It is the responsibility of our employees and volunteers to keep our customers, their families, and our communities safe from abuse. […]
